The 2017 Subaru Forester has 1 recall campaign as of August 2026. NHTSA rated it 5 out of 5 stars overall. EPA combined fuel economy: 25 MPG.
Tested configuration: 2017 Subaru Forester SUV AWD
Recall campaigns apply to the model year, not to one car. Check remedy status for this VIN at nhtsa.gov/recalls.
Model-level data for the 2017 Subaru Forester from NHTSA (recalls, NCAP crash tests) and EPA fueleconomy.gov, refreshed August 27, 2026.
